How much do comic writers get paid per page?

Q: How much money do comic book writers get paid? A: Estimates range from $100 per page on the lower end, up to $300 or more on the higher end for comic book writers at the big companies.

How much should I pay for a letterer?

Letterer. This is the person who uses a variety of fonts and sometimes even hand-drawn calligraphy to create everything in the word balloons and illustrating the sound effects. Typically this job runs between $10 and $25 per page, according to the FairPageRates survey.

How much does a comic page cost?

Pencil and inker artists can ask for $75 to $200 a page. Colorists often fall in the range of $35 to $125, and writers and letterers make $10 to $50 a page. A lucky few dozen famous artists working for top companies bring in $1,000 per page.”

What happens if I submit a proposal to Image Comics?

Do not hand Image Comics employees submissions at comic book conventions. Your submission will be misplaced or discarded. Due to a high volume of submissions we are unable to respond to each proposal individually. If you do not receive a reply within one month of submitting consider your proposal declined.
